Continuity when infrastructure is under stress
How can local energy storage and battery systems support continuity when centralized infrastructure is delayed, unstable, expensive, or unavailable?Energy is becoming more local, electronic, and software-mediated. Homes, sites, devices, field operations, and intelligent systems increasingly depend on power decisions that ordinary users rarely see.
Why it matters
The question is not only battery capacity. It is what should continue operating, what should pause, what should recover first, and how people can understand the state of the system when infrastructure is under stress.
Future systems may need to behave less like distant utilities and more like recoverable local infrastructure.
